If you’re a veteran, service member, or military-affiliated student looking to study indian/native american education, you’ve come to the right place. We have ranked 1 college ranked on how well they support veterans pursuing indian/native american education, using our 2026 methodology.

We measure this ranking on the factors that matter most to veteran and military-affiliated students: affordability and veteran financial benefits (including GI Bill and Yellow Ribbon support), academic quality, on-campus veteran resources and support services, veteran-friendly policies, and the size of the veteran student community. To help you decide, College Factual reviewed colleges nationwide, drawing primarily on U.S. Department of Education data (IPEDS and College Scorecard).
